This evidence-based manual highlights the early management of acutely injured trauma victims arriving in emergency triage areas. It caters to the needs of developing nations in pre-hospital as well as in-hospital emergency trauma care and provides clear practical guidelines for the management of victims of major trauma.

Dr Kajal Jain, MD, MAMS, FICA is a consultant anaesthetist at premier institute, PGIMER, Chandigarh. She is the program Director for a three-year academic postdoctoral DM Course in Trauma Anaesthesia and Acute Care. Dr Nidhi Bhatia, MD, DNB, MAMS is consultant anaesthetist in Department of Anaesthesia and Intensive Care, PGIMER, Chandigarh. She is the Core Faculty in a three-year academic postdoctoral DM Course in Trauma Anaesthesia and Acute Care.
